COP28 president calls on governments to raise climate targets by September

Brussels: Governments should raise their climate targets within the next two months, the United Arab Emirates’ president of the upcoming COP28 global climate conference said on Thursday.

“I call on all governments to update their NDCs by September of this year, ensuring alignment with the Paris Agreement,” Sultan Ahmed al-Jaber said, referring to “Nationally Determined Contributions”, the emissions-cutting pledges that serve as countries’ national contributions to meeting the 2015 Paris Agreement’s goals to curb climate change.
